FAQ: How do staff access the bike cage and parking gates at Corvel Wharf? The bike cage sits behind Building C and is covered by CCTV; the two vehicle gates open automatically on exit but require authorisation on entry. Team assistants arranging access for new joiners should submit the standard facilities form first. Until a personal badge is issued, both the cage and entry gates accept the code below.

door code, yagag-yajog: bdg-PO-2

## Brimvale CI — Environments: Clock Skew

Build agents in the Tolbury pool drift up to 40s; artifact signing fails when skew exceeds 30s. If builds fail with stale-timestamp errors, restart the agent's time-sync daemon before retrying. Do not bump the signing tolerance without approval from the Lanefield platform team. The current skew thresholds and sync intervals are set as follows.

settings of tajep-tafog:
CASDOR_LOG_LEVEL=info
CASDOR_METRICS_HOST=metrics.casdor.nelvrosys.internal
CASDOR_POOL_SIZE=16

## Changelog — Lanternleaf App v5.9.0

Third-party display fonts are now vendored into the app bundle instead of being fetched at startup. Support notes: customers behind strict proxies should no longer see the blank-text bug on first launch, and the "fonts loading" spinner has been removed entirely. Offline installs render correctly on first run. No user action is required; a reinstall picks up the bundled fonts. Escalate any remaining rendering reports to the owner named below.

signatory, kaweg-fawig: Zorys Druys Jorius Novael

## Runbook: Dispatcher heuristic acting up

If Hailrig starts assigning drivers to pickups way across town, the heuristic has probably degraded — usually because the traffic-weight feed went stale. First check the feed age metric; anything over ten minutes means the scorer is flying blind and falling back to straight-line distance, which looks dumb but is expected. Restart the scorer pod only if the feed is fresh. The heuristic's current tuning parameters are listed below.

config for yajep-tafof:
[rusath]
team = julmir
access_code = ac_fe37fd
host = rusath.novactech.test
port = 8000
owner = pelmir.weneth
peer = oliwyn.olvarqdyn.internal